  • Title

    Ultrafast laser pulse spectral domain differential phase shift keying

  • Abstract
    Pulse spectral-domain differential-phase-shift-keying has been demonstrated using AOM-based pulse shaping for modulation and spectral interferometry for demodulation. The encoded differential phase is successfully retrieved despite of the nonlinear distortions after 4-km dispersion-shifted fiber transmission.
